Asbestos trust funds are a pool of money that are set aside by asbestos producers to compensate victims suffering from mesothelioma, or other asbestos-related diseases. They are regulated by the U.S. Bankruptcy code and are designed to compensate those who have suffered from negligence in asbestos exposure.
The mesothelioma payment amount from a trust fund varies greatly and is contingent on the severity of your asbestos-related health as well as the amount of losses you have suffered in the past and in the future and whether you were employed at one or more asbestos-related businesses. Some trusts have a percentage they pay out for each claim. The percentages vary from 1-100%.

Statute of limitations
In order for victims to receive compensation, they must make a claim within the timeframe of the statute of limitation. This time limit can vary by state and type of claim. Most personal injury and wrongful death lawsuits have time limits of between one and three years. The time limit for mesothelioma lawsuits is usually shorter than other personal injury lawsuits. This is due to the long mesothelioma's period of latency and other asbestos-related diseases.
While certain states have their own statute of limitations, certain asbestos trusts have their own rules on the time frame for submitting asbestos claims. Mesothelioma Trusts generally require that patients submit claims three years following the diagnosis.
In addition, the duration of treatment for mesothelioma survivors could be tolled or extended in the event that they have been diagnosed with more than one type of asbestos-related disease. This includes mesothelioma, asbestosis and pleural effusion.
In some situations, the statute of limitations might be extended or waived in the case of an active duty soldier. This is due to the fact that soldiers are often exposed to asbestos while serving in the military and must abide by different laws.
If the time limit has passed the mesothelioma lawyer may still help patients pursue other sources of compensation. For instance, they may assist patients in filing a lawsuit in a different state, or seeking asbestos trust funds or veterans benefits.
